What affects the price

When you plan a total home transformation, the final number depends on several moving parts. The biggest factors are the square footage involved, the current condition of your home’s systems, and the level of finishes you choose. Opting for high-end materials like custom cabinetry or premium stone countertops will push your budget higher than standard selections. What is the difference between renovating and remodeling?

Renovating typically means restoring something to a good state of repair, like fixing up an older home's original features. Remodeling involves changing the structure or design of a space, such as knocking down walls for an open-concept living area in your Tampa residence. Both can significantly improve your home's functionality and appeal.

Is it cheaper to buy a house or remodel?

Generally, it can be cheaper to remodel an existing home than to buy a new one, especially in a competitive market like Tampa. However, this depends heavily on the extent of the remodel. A major gut renovation could end up costing as much as or more than purchasing a new property. Consider the long-term costs and potential resale value.
